Ultrasound Tech Occupation Summary

Saint Stephen SC ultrasound tech with patientThere are more than one acceptable titles for ultrasound techs (technicians). They are also called ultrasound technologists, sonogram techs, and diagnostic medical sonographers (or just sonographers). No matter what their title is, they all have the same primary job function, which is to carry out diagnostic ultrasound techniques on patients. Even though many work as generalists there are specialties within the field, for instance in cardiology and pediatrics. Most work in Saint Stephen SC hospitals, clinics, private practices or outpatient diagnostic imaging centers. Typical daily work duties of an ultrasound tech may involve:

  • Preserving records of patient medical histories and details of each procedure
  • Counseling patients by explaining the procedures and answering questions
  • Prepping the ultrasound machines for usage and then cleaning and re-calibrating them
  • Escorting patients to treatment rooms and making them comfortable
  • Operating equipment while minimizing patient exposure to sound waves
  • Assessing results and determining necessity for further testing

Ultrasound techs must regularly evaluate the performance and safety of their equipment. They also are held to a high ethical standard and code of conduct as medical practitioners. So as to sustain that level of professionalism and remain current with medical knowledge, they are mandated to enroll in continuing education courses on a regular basis.

Ultrasound Technician Degrees Offered

Saint Stephen SC ultrasound technician performing sonographyUltrasound tech enrollees have the opportunity to acquire either an Associate Degree or a Bachelor’s Degree. An Associate Degree will typically involve about 18 months to 2 years to complete dependent on the program and class load. A Bachelor’s Degree will take longer at up to 4 years to complete. Another option for those who have already obtained a college degree is a post graduate certificate program. If you have received a Bachelor’s Degree in any major or an Associate Degree in a related medical sector, you can instead choose a certificate program that will take just 12 to 18 months to complete. Something to bear in mind is that the majority of sonographer colleges do have a clinical training component as a portion of their course of study. It can often be fulfilled by entering into an internship program which numerous schools sponsor through Saint Stephen SC hospitals and clinics. After you have graduated from any of the certificate or degree programs, you will then need to fulfill the licensing or certification prerequisites in South Carolina or whichever state you decide to work in.

Online Ultrasound Technician Schools

student attending online sonography class in Saint Stephen SCAs earlier discussed, almost all sonogram technician schools have a clinical component to their programs. So while you can earn a degree or certificate online, a substantial portion of the training will be either held in an on-campus lab or at an authorized off campus facility. Practical training can typically be satisfied by means of an internship at a local Saint Stephen SC outpatient clinic, hospital or family practice. But the balance of the classes and training may be attended online in your Saint Stephen home. This is particularly convenient for those individuals that continue working while getting their degrees. In addition online programs are many times less expensive than on-campus alternatives. Expenses for study materials and commuting can be decreased also. But similarly as with every sonography program you are reviewing, check that the online school you select is accredited. Among the most highly regarded accrediting agencies is the Commission on Accreditation of Allied Health Education Programs (CAAHEP). Accreditation is especially important for certification, licensing and finding employment (more on accreditation later). Are the Ultrasound Tech Schools Accredited? Most ultrasound technician schools have acquired some type of accreditation, whether national or regional. Even so, it’s still imperative to confirm that the school and program are accredited. One of the most highly regarded accrediting agencies in the field of sonography is the Joint Review Committee on Education in Diagnostic Medical Sonography (JRC-DMS). Programs obtaining accreditation from the JRC-DMS have gone through a rigorous evaluation of their instructors and educational materials. If the college is online it might also receive accreditation from the Distance Education and Training Council, which targets online or distance education. All accrediting organizations should be acknowledged by the U.S. Department of Education or the Council on Higher Education Accreditation. In addition to guaranteeing a premium education, accreditation will also help in getting financial aid and student loans, which are many times not available for non-accredited programs. Accreditation may also be a pre-requisite for certification and licensing as required. And a number of Saint Stephen SC health facilities will only hire a graduate of an accredited program for entry-level openings.

Sonographer colleges require that you have a high school diploma or equivalent. Apart from meeting academic standards, you must be in at least reasonably good physical health, able to stand for prolonged durations and able to regularly lift weights of 50 pounds or more, as is it frequently necessary to position patients and move heavy machinery. Other beneficial skills include technical aptitude, the ability to stay calm when faced with an anxious or angry patient and the ability to communicate in a clear and compassionate manner.
